Beta is here.

Yeah, another S2 hack, I'm bored. Emerald Hill 1 through Chemical Plant 2 has been designed, with a few lagging layout choices from Turbo (the good parts, I swear). Special Stage 1 is done up to the second checkpoint; everything after that is leftover from Sonic 2. Levels are longer this time around due to ASM modding being more forgiving than hex modding.  That pesky aerial speedcap is nerfed too.

I have music plans, but as with Turbo I'll worry about new sound driver implementation at a later date. I'll use the Sonic 1 driver instead of the Sonic 2 Beta driver this time around, so no screechy noises.

Pretty self-explanatory; don't get hit or die in a level to double your ring bonus. The removal of the perfect bonus also allows for using "object rings" in the level, effectively nulling the 255-ring-per-act limit in Sonic 2.

^ I'm drawing those letters, so there's whatever I draw in. But the space between Perfect and Bonus has to stay the same, as that's programmed and not part of the drawing. If I put space at the beginning or stretch the letters, it'll look distorted.

From Sonic Retro:

Okay, a small beta is available here, so DL and comment on anything and everything, please. Music, art, layout, bugs... every tip counts. If you're looking for screens, the video from the first post is pretty close to the current beta.

Current Status
- Layouts up to Chemical Plant 2 are finished, and Special Stage 1 is done
- Sonic 1 Sound Driver ported, about half of tunes modified to work correctly
- Hub /overworld system half-implemented

Eventually-To-Be
- Character-specific programming (i.e. Tails flying)
- More layouts and special stages, obviously
-DNXDelta doesn't have much in this beta, but he's working on other things such as this.


Issues
- Sonic 1 Sound Driver is buggy as hell. Srsly.
- Layouts are designed with character-specific abilities in mind, so some things are unreachable.

Credits
shobiz - general tech help as well as guide for S3K Rings in S2
All who worked on the S1 Sound Driver in S2
Irixion - traded information to him, received S3K DAC in return :P
